(Decides the following):
Article One: 
Approval of Fees for reservation, allocation and usage of numbers in accordance with what was stated in Annex No. (1), and it  will be applied as of the date of this Decision in regard to reservation, allocation and usage of the new numbers, as for the current used numbers application will be as of 1/4/1425H corresponding to 20/5/2004, in order to give a transitional period for the current numbers users to review the current numbers used by them and the extent of their need to keep these numbers and to inform the Commission with the results.
Article Two: 
This Decision shall be communicated to Saudi Telecommunications Company and the concerned parties to act accordingly.

Fees for Numbers Allocation and Usage
The number is any number allocated for a specific service, used by the Customer and the number of its digits is composed of the call code allocated for the service and the Customer number which is called (National Significant Number- NSN) pursuant to the definition of the ICU, with the exclusion of the Telex services numbers and Data numbers for example the fixed telephone number (1-4648000) is composed of 8 digits and the number of mobile (5-52922518) is composed of 9 digits and the free number (8001232222) is composed of 10 digits. The Fees are proposed to be as follows:
Number digits No. Fees for every number upon allocation and paid once (Halala) Annual Fees for usage of every number (Halala)
  • 8 digits & more 10 Halala 30 Halala
  • 7 10x10 30x10
  • 6 10x10x10 30x10x10
  • 5 10x10x10x10 30x10x10x10
  • 4 10x10x10x10x10 30x10x10x10x10
  • 3 (*) 10x10x10x10x10x100 30x10x10x10x10x100
1. (*) Numbers designated for security agencies are excluded from the tripled numbers which are included in Appendix (10) Type (A) of the National Numbering Plan.
2. When submitting a request for numbers allocation, the service provider will pay 50% of the fees for allocation and the remaining 50% will be completed upon allocation request submittal, in case of allocation request without reservation the allocation Fees shall be paid all at once.
